About Us:

BW Design Group is a fully integrated architecture, engineering, construction, system integration, and consulting firm committed to helping our clients realize their most critical goals from Strategy to Commercialization. As the only firm born from a manufacturing technology company to become an independent and fully integrated firm, we combine deep domain expertise in the manufacturing environment with an approach that is built to serve the dynamic needs of our clients. Rooted in our distinct culture of Truly Human Leadership, we cultivate the leaders who will define tomorrow and partner with our clients in the food & beverage, life sciences, industrial, and advanced technology industries to build the future of manufacturing and technology.


 

Barry-Wehmiller is a diversified global supplier of engineering consulting and manufacturing technology for the packaging, corrugating, sheeting and paper-converting industries. By blending people-centric leadership with disciplined operational strategies and purpose-driven growth, Barry-Wehmiller has become a $3 billion organization with nearly 12,000 team members united by a common belief: to use the power of business to build a better world.


 

Job Description:

The IT Intern applies basic understanding of PC build fundamentals and looks for process improvement ideas.  Quick to learn and understand enterprise PC building software tools after initial training and gain corporate PC build experience.

This Intern will join a global team that provides support for PC hardware and software support to 1,500 global employees.  This position will focus on PC delivery to employees in the US and identify PC build process improvements.  The PC Specialist Intern will learn and work with enterprise tools to help deploy new PC’s in a quick and efficient manner.

Preference will be given to candidates who are based in the St. Louis area and available to continue part-time during the academic year

Responsibilities 

  • Ability to multitask and stay organized with multiple work streams simultaneously.

  • Ability to provide professional written and verbal communication.

  • Ability to remain customer focused with all aspects of the job.

  • Configures, assembles and installs laptops, workstations and/or peripheral equipment. 

  • PC configuration and troubleshooting skills.

  • Update and maintain team documentation. 

  • May provide user orientation on standard hardware or software. 

Requirements

  • Strong familiarity with Microsoft Operations Systems.

  • 6 months experience with PC support or PC builds preferred. 

  • Basic understanding of computer hardware, software, and networking concepts.

  • Experience with troubleshooting and providing support for IT-related issues.

  • Knowledge of IT security best practices.

  • Basic knowledge of scripting languages (e.g., Python, PowerShell).

  • Familiarity with Windows operating systems.

  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team.

  • Strong problem-solving skills and attention to detail.

  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.

  • Eagerness to learn and adapt to new technologies.

Education

  • Currently enrolled in a relevant degree program (Computer Science, Information Technology, or related field).

  • CompTIA A+ Certification or progress is preferred.
